The cheapest way to get from Dublin to Larne Port is to train which costs £24 - £35 and takes 3h 40m.
The fastest way to get from Dublin to Larne Port is to drive which takes 2h 9m and costs £30 - £45.
No, there is no direct bus from Dublin to Larne Port. However, there are services departing from The Gresham Hotel and arriving at Larne Methodist Church via Bridge Street.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 20m.
No, there is no direct ferry from Dublin to Larne Port. However, there are services departing from Dublin Terminal 1 and arriving at Port of Larne via Isle of Man Douglas.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 8h 45m.
No, there is no direct train from Dublin to Larne Port. However, there are services departing from Dublin Connolly and arriving at Larne Harbour via Belfast Grand Central.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 40m.
The distance between Dublin and Larne Port is 139 miles. The road distance is 128.3 miles.
The best way to get from Dublin to Larne Port without a car is to train which takes 3h 40m and costs £24 - £35.
It takes approximately 3h 40m to get from Dublin to Larne Port, including transfers.
Dublin to Larne Port bus services, operated by Aircoach, depart from The Gresham Hotel station.
Dublin to Larne Port train services, operated by Iarnród Éireann (Irish Rail), depart from Dublin Connolly station.
